Information on the 2022 registration fee will be available in early October. This is a second chance to pass the subject, and students must pass the additional exam to get a global pass. The best possible result of an additional exam is SP (additional pass) or SS (additional pass in an ungraded subject). Additional examinations are scheduled after the formal examination period and may not be available for all subjects or for all types of examinations.
